James Taylor's voice is so recognizable, so easy and so perfect. His 1987 Greatest Hits album is a classic - one of the highest selling albums of all time. And for great reason - its 12 perfect songs, all working wonderfully alongside one another. From Something in the Way She Moves to Steamroller - James Taylor's Greatest hits is perfect for a lazy sunday, an afternoon at the beach, or a cross country car ride... just as JT would like it

1. Something In The Way She Moves
2. Carolina In My Mind
3. Fire And Rain
4. Sweet Baby James
5. Country Road
6. You've Got A Friend
7. Don't Let Me Be Lonely Tonight
8. Walking Man
9. How Sweet It Is (To Be Loved By You)
10. Mexico
11. Shower The People
12. Steamroller - (live)
